WHY FERTILISER IS ESSENTIAL FOR YOUR LAWN?

The soil used for maintaining a buffalo lawn Sydney is not always nutrient-rich. In this situation, it will not be helpful to any turf as far as growth is concerned, and no wonder the installed turf will dry and eventually die. But this can be prevented entirely by understanding that several Sydney turf supplies are needed, including fertilisers. Fertiliser application will infuse micro-nutrients into the soil, allowing any turf, including buffalo turf in Sydney, to grow well. These nutrients could include n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ium and so on. They will provide all the essential ingredients that soil needs to assist any turf, including buffalo turf in Sydney, to grow well.

WHAT TO FERTILISE A LAWN WITH?

A couple of types of fertilisers are available at the vendors of Sydney turf supplies. The first is synthetic fertilisers, and the second is organic fertilisers.

WHAT ARE SYNTHETIC FERTILISERS?

These fertilisers used for buffalo turf in Sydney have inorganic chemicals to provide nutrients to the lawn. But they are not beneficial at all for the soil. In fact, it has been noticed in some cases that these fertilisers are harmful if misapplied, and they are primarily present in liquid or granular form.

WHAT ARE ORGANIC FERTILISERS?

Organic fertilisers offered by the vendors of Sydney turf supplies are made up of natural, biodegradable materials. This includes animal manure, compost, mineral deposits, sea-weeds and others to improve the soil structure and water holding capacity. The buffalo lawn in Sydney will also develop nutrient-holding ability with these fertilisers. A good thing about them is that they don’t cause any harm to the soil as synthetic fertilisers do sometimes.
